    drivers: remove the SGI SN2 IOC4 base support · f7bc6e42
    Christoph Hellwig authored Aug 13, 2019
    
    
    The IOC4 is a multi-function chip seen on SGI SN2 and some SGI MIPS
    systems.  This removes the base driver, which while not having an SN2
    Kconfig dependency was only for sub-drivers that had one.
